Lutz, Moussa, Cuffe Lead Top Preps Into San Diego

The USATF Cross Country Championships take place this weekend in sunny San Diego, as some of the top senior and junior talent square off to earn a trip to represent the US in Spain at the IAAF World Cross Country Championships. 

Leading the charge in the junior men's race are prep stars Craig Lutz (TX) and Ammar Moussa (CA). Moussa stepped up big in 2010, earning a spot on the American junior squad by finishing sixth overall. Moussa then went on to place 66th overall at the IAAF World Cross Country Championships in Poland. 

Meanwhile, Lutz competes in his first USATF XC Championship event. Lutz had an amazing fall harrier season, and should challenge for the top spot on Saturday. The University of Texas signee seems poised to take challenge for victory and lead the US junior contingent in Spain.

On the junior women's side, Aisling Cuffe (NY) is the odds-on-favorite to win. Cuffe steamrolled the competition this past fall, winning every title imaginable, including the Foot Locker National Championship. The Villanova recruit has continued to look strong in practice and is excited for her first crack and representing the US.
